Megan Marrin
Megan Marrins work often has a feeling of timeless melancholia. This sense is helped by her use of vintage photographic material that she has amassed over time from estate sales and flea markets. She derives a lot of her influences from literature, music and dialogue.
Living and working in New York she has exhibited painting, sculpture, photography and mixed media throughout the US and in 2005 was recognised by Art Review as one of 25 Emerging US Artists in an exhibition at Phillips de Pury and Company.
